Fort Santiago, dating from the late 1500s, guards the entrance to Intramuros and served as a prison under both Spanish colonial rule and the Japanese occupation. In the dungeons – where prisoners are said to have drowned as the river tide rose, and hundreds died during World War II – visitors report screams, whispers and sudden chills. National hero José Rizal was also imprisoned here before his execution in 1896, and some claim to have glimpsed his figure on the grounds. Today the fort is one of Manila's most visited historic sites – beautiful in sunlight, unnerving at dusk.
